Lamborghini celebrates 10,000th Gallardo
The Lamborghini Gallardo has become the Italian manufacturer’s most successful model to date, as the 10,000th car rolls off the production line at its Sant’Agata Bolognese factory. The 10,000th Gallardo was finished in Midas yellow and delivered to a customer … Continue reading

McLaren MP4-12C – have your say
If you made something as gorgeous, desirable and mind-blowing as the McLaren F1, you’d not exactly be in a rush to replace it. That’s why it has taken the Woking-based supercar geniuses 16 years to officially reveal their next offering.
